61-17 Statutes for the maintenance of facilities in Bad Godesberg, Plittersdorf
Statutes of the City of Bonn on the preservation of buildings - Bad Godesberg, Plittersdorf
From July 14, 1988
At its meeting on June 30, 1988, the Bonn City Council adopted the following bylaws on the basis of Section 4 ( 1) of the Municipal Code for the State of North Rhine-Westphalia in the version published on August 13, 1984 (GV. NW. p. 475), last amended by the law of October 6, 1987 (GV. NW. p. 342), and Section 172 of the Federal Building Act (BBauG) in the version published on December 8, 1986 (BGBl. I p. 2253):
§ 1: Local scope of application
The area of application of these statutes lies in the district of Bad Godesberg, Plittersdorf, between Von-Sandt-Ufer, Simrockallee, Ubierstraße, Plittersdorfer Straße including the house plots 131 to 181, Steinstraße including the property of the playground in the corner area of Plittersdorfer Straße/Steinstraße, Wurzerstraße including the house plots 191 to 195, Turmstraße including the house plots 13 to 27a, Vikariegasse including house plot 3, house plots 1 to 29 and 2 to 28 on both sides of Annettenstrasse, including house plots Donatusstrasse 6, 8 and 10, Sybillenstrasse 32 to 38 and 51 to 59 and Steinstrasse 31 to 37, Steinstrasse, Leonardusstrasse including house plots 4 to 24 and Turmstrasse 33 to 35 and 26, Auerhofstrasse including house plots 1 to 9 and the mausoleum.
The boundary is shown in the attached plan, which forms part of these bylaws.
§ 2: Material scope of application
A large number of buildings worthy of preservation are located in the area covered by these bylaws, which, either on their own or in conjunction with other buildings, significantly shape the urban character of the entire historically evolved streetscape and townscape of this part of Plittersdorf.
In accordance with § 172 Para. 1 No. 1 BauGB and § 3, these statutes serve to preserve the urban character of this part of Plittersdorf. It applies irrespective of existing development plans, design statutes and the obligation to obtain approval for building structures in accordance with the building regulations for the state of North Rhine-Westphalia.
§ 3: Approval of structural installations
Within the scope of these bylaws, approval for the construction, demolition, alteration or change of use of structures may be refused for the reasons specifically described in paragraph 2; this does not apply to internal conversions and internal alterations to structures that do not affect the external appearance of the structure.
Approval for the demolition, alteration or change of use of structures may only be refused if the structure a) alone or in conjunction with other structures, it affects the townscape, the urban form or the landscape, or b) is otherwise of urban planning, in particular historical or artistic, significance.
Permission to erect a building may only be refused if the urban design of the area is impaired by the intended building.
§ 4: Administrative offenses
Any person who demolishes or modifies a building structure in the area specified in § 1 without permission is in breach of the provisions of § 213 Para. 1 No. 4 BBauG. The administrative offense can be punished with a fine of up to EUR 25,564.59 in accordance with Section 213 (2) BBauG.
§ 5: Entry into force
These Articles of Association shall enter into force upon their public announcement.

The bylaws are hereby made public.
The statutes and the plan attached to the statutes as an integral part are available for inspection by anyone during office hours at the Land Registry and Surveying Office, City Hall, Berliner Platz 2, elevator 2, floor 7 C.
Notice: Reference is made to the provisions of Section 173 (2) in conjunction with Section 44 (3) and (4) of the German Building Code on the timely assertion of any claims for compensation in the event of the refusal of approval pursuant to Section 3 of these bylaws.
Defects or deficiencies within the meaning of Section 214 (3) of the German Building Code in the creation of these bylaws are irrelevant if they have not been asserted in writing to the City of Bonn within seven years of this announcement. The facts on which the defect is based must be stated.
A violation of procedural or formal regulations of the municipal code for the state of North Rhine-Westphalia in the creation of these bylaws can no longer be asserted after the expiry of one year since this announcement, unless
a prescribed approval is missing,
these bylaws have not been duly published,
the Chief Town Clerk has previously objected to the resolution on the statutes or
the City of Bonn has been notified of the formal or procedural defect in advance, stating the legal provision infringed and the fact that reveals the defect.
